     [Award of the Rising Star] This name is being returned for lack
of documentation of the
     construction of the order name. No documentation was provided,
and the College found
     none, that an abstract descriptive such as Rising was used to
modify a noun such as Star
     in period order names. Barring such documentation, this name must
be returned.
     [Ansteorra, Kingdom of, 09/01, R-Ansteorra]
